隧道六部台阶开挖法施工

摘    要:隧道工程在地质较差地段,传统上是采用单、双侧壁导坑法施工,该法工序较多,施工面狭小,需要进行临时支护,难以发挥机械的作用,因此施工进度缓慢,效率低.灵山一标白羊铺1#隧道,采用六部台阶开挖法施工,开挖作业快速、稳定,在保证安全掘进的基础上,大大加快了隧道的掘进效率.值得总结推广.

Abstract:The single and double side drift method is usually adopted to construct tunnel engineering in poor geological section. This method has been lots of processes and narrow construction area. It needs temporary support, and mechanical can hardly to play its role so that the construction progress is slow and inefficient. Baiyangpu 1# tunnel in Lingshan has been constructed by six-step excavation method. The excavation work is fast and stable. Based on the ensuring of safety tunneling, it has greatly accelerated the efficiency of tunneling, which is worth for summing up and generalization.
